The deafening echo’s of the arena could match any major classed earthquake with how loud everything felt. The walls behind the stage and under the arena shook with force, you couldn’t keep a cup down without it vibrating off the table. New Era’s premiere event of the year Vindication 3 was only half-way into effect but the night was already as magical as the city that hosted this grand event. Down the halls we find stage crew members, security making patrols, celebrities and other personal alike littered the arena but the deeper we went in, the more scare the existence of humanity.
It was in the last door, just before the boiler room where we stopped the camera, the last room with it’s door just open by an inch. Like the cat the camera curious found its way into the room where we found it almost empty; empty except for the slouching figure, his back to the door as he sat on a bench. The closer the camera moved in the more clear we could make out the scars that are scattered around his shoulders and lower back. His head dropped but he could tell of the presence as we too quickly made out the body to be Nightmare.
“One would think that this match I had tonight was the setback everyone expected me to have; full of talk but yet never able to capitalize for a victory.”
Gavin chuckles to himself as he turns himself around on the bench to face the camera, you could see the bruising that Lucifer had inflicted into Gavin’s body as his shoulders and throat show the signs of said damage.
“But I will allow those who talk ill of me to continue to speak there claims with no sign of truth. I say this because I told you all that in victory or defeat I would make my impact be felt; I warned you all that I would make everyone know that I am here not as the steeping stone but the landslide I am growing to become.” [/b][/color]
“Tonight in that ring I took the biggest man in this company to his deepest limits, I pushed Lucifer Hawks to the brink of defeat. Though his mask hid his anguish I could tell that he was wearing down as all giants slowly do. Lucifer did pick up the victory but it was I who found the glory that came with such a match; throat raw and body sore I stand to all now as the broken man most would expect me to be.”
Gavin lets out a chuckle as he stands to his feet.
“For those who paid attention I want you to realize that it wasn’t a move that was Lucifer’s that defeated me; it was my own. Lucifer realized that to defeat me he had to mimic the same move that was slowly tearing his foundation to the crumbling ruins that was leading to his downfall. And unlike those who constantly ignore me Lucifer took notice; Lucifer made me give in to my own creation and left me laying with a Chelsea Grin.”
“Tonight was only the beginning of the storm that I am; Lucifer can vouch that I am not the person everyone expects to face in this ring. The cinders of my rage are growing inside me; the cinders are what’s guiding me to my success. So I take the loss of battle because I know war is far from over between me and New Era. So send in your warriors; give me your tributes and sacrificial lambs Nikki and I will make you watch in horror as I carve out there eyes and give them an everlasting image of my destruction. I don’t need to let cheap tricks and horror movies talk for me; I don’t need to pander to the fans anymore because I know they don’t pander to me.”
Gavin chuckles once more as he drops his head, his voice quietly dropping to a lull as he stands in the room.
“Hell is coming Nikki Blaine; the dead are stirring in their makeshift graves and sacrificial landmarks.”
Gavin looks up at the camera, his sick and twisted grin planted firmly on his face.
“Hell is coming Nikki and there isn’t anyone in this company that can detour me anymore.”
On those words we watch as Gavin chuckles to himself as he stares at the camera; the camera man slowly backing out and away from the room as we quickly cut to static.
